- 博客(53)
- 收藏
- 关注
原创 Python中数据类型
计算机顾名思义就是可以做数学计算的机器,因此,计算机程序理所当然地可以处理各种数值。但是,计算机能处理的远不止数值,还可以处理文本、图形、音频、视频、网页等各种各样的数据,不同的数据,需要定义不同的数据类型。在Python中,能够直接处理的数据类型有以下几种:一、整数Python可以处理任意大小的整数,当然包括负整数,在Python程序中,整数的表示方法和数学上的写法一模一样,例如:1,1
2018-01-04 11:39:35 309
原创 Python_test10-11
题目:打印出所有的“水仙花数”,所谓“水仙花数”是指一个三位数,其各位数字立方和等于该数本身。例如:153是一个“水仙花数”,因为153=1的三次方+5的三次方+3的三次方。程序分析:利用for循环控制100-999个数,每个数分解出个位,十位,百位。# 方法1:for x in range(1,10): for y in range(0,10): for
2017-12-25 14:44:12 255
原创 Python_test08-09
题目:有一对兔子,从出生后第3个月起每个月都生一对兔子,小兔子长到第三个月后每个月又生一对兔子,假如兔子都不死,问20个月后兔子总数为多少?程序分析: 兔子的规律为数列1,1,2,3,5,8,13,21....# 斐波那契数列# 迭代def fab(n): n1 = 1 n2 = 1 n3 = 1 #设置默认值为1 if n < 1:
2017-12-23 15:19:36 292
原创 Python_test06-07
题目:输出特殊图案,请在c环境中运行,看一看,Very Beautiful!1.程序分析:字符共有256个。不同字符,图形不一样。 a = 176b = 218print(chr(b),chr(a),chr(a),chr(a),chr(b))print(chr(a),chr(b),chr(a),chr(b),chr(a))print(chr(a),chr(a),chr(b),ch
2017-12-22 15:46:03 211
原创 Postman讲解
模拟HTTP Requests请求Request1、URL2、Method:根据方法的不同,body编辑器会发生变化3、Headers4、Body:1)from-data:网页表单用来传输数据的默认格式。可以模拟填写表单,并且提交表单;可以上传一个文件作为key的value提交。但该文件不会作为历史保存,每次需要发送请求的时候,重新添加文件。2)x-www-ur
2017-11-28 16:58:32 550
原创 接口测试抓包工具
主要抓包工具介绍与对比1、Wireshark:通用的抓包工具,抓取信息量庞大,需要过滤才能得到有用的信息,只有HTTP请求有点大材小用2、Firebug、HttpWatch等web调试工具:不够给力,功能欠缺3、Charles:各有千秋,MAC上对Charles支持更好4、Fiddler:概念1)Fiddler是位于客户端和服务器的Http代理,它能记录所有客户端和服务
2017-11-28 10:56:20 1698
原创 Http协议讲解
感谢老K提供的视频教学,让我们能开始学习Python的接口自动化,从今天开始记录跟着老K好好学习天天向上吧。02 HTTP协议讲解HTTP协议简述1、五层网络架构:1)应用层:规定应用数据的数据格式:(1)HTTP:超文本传输协议 (2)H
2017-11-23 11:37:59 360
原创 Python_test04-05
题目:输入三个整数x,y,z,请把这三个数由小到大输出。1.程序分析:输入3次整数,所以就使用for循环,然后输出在一个列表中,再对列表进行排序# coding=utf-8list = [] #创建一个列表for i in range(1,4): number = int(input(("请输入第%d个数字: ")%i)) list.append(number
2017-11-21 11:17:08 231
原创 Python_test02-03
题目:一个整数,它加上100后是一个完全平方数,再加上268又是一个完全平方数,请问该数是多少?1.程序分析:在10万以内判断,先将该数加上100后再开方,再将该数加上268后再开方,如果开方后的结果满足如下条件,即是结果。请看具体分析:import mathfor i in range(10000): x = int(math.sqrt(i+100)) y = int
2017-11-20 13:11:03 414 1
原创 Python_test00-01
Python_test00题目:有1、2、3、4个数字,能组成多少个互不相同且无重复数字的三位数?都是多少?1.程序分析:可填在百位、十位、个位的数字都是1、2、3、4。组成所有的排列后再去掉不满足条件的排列。for i in range(1,5): for j in range(1,5): for k in range(1,5):
2017-11-17 15:03:02 346
原创 笨方法学习Python-习题37: 复习各种符号
笨方法学习Python,Python的关键字,字符串格式化,字符串转义序列以及Python的基本数据类型
2017-10-31 09:53:35 658
原创 笨方法学习Python-习题35: 分支和函数
笨方法学习Python,Python中的if语句,while循环,Python的逻辑运算符等知识点
2017-10-26 15:46:58 694 1
原创 笨方法学习Python-习题25: 更多更多的练习
笨方法学习Python,另外学习了Python3中的help()函数、list.pop()函数、list.split()截取函数、list.sorted()函数
2017-10-24 10:50:03 383
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人